MOA of ACE inhibitors
- Inhibiton of production of angiotensin2
Dilation of arterioles ↓ pvr ↓bp
↓aldesterone ↓ na and h2o retention
↓ sympathetic nervous activity
2.inhibit degradation of bradykinin( vasodilator) by ace
3.stimulate synthesis of PGs by bradykinin
MOA of ARBs
ARBs competitively inhibit binding of ang2 to AT1 receptors and block its effect
Not affect bradykinin
MOA of diuretics
Why thiazide prefer over loop diuretics and when to prefer loop?
Thiazide → inhibit na+ and cl- symport in early dct → promote na+ h2o excretion → ↓ CO ↓ bp
↓
On chronic therapy
↓ na+ in vascular smooth muscle ↓ pvr ↓ bp
Loop diuretics have short duration of action so sustained low level na+ not maintained in blood and thiazide have longer duration of action
Thiazide- in uncomplicated HNT
Loop- HNT with renal and cardiac failure
MOA of CCBs :the first line drug for HNT
Which CCB safe in pregnancy
CCBs block voltage sensitive L type Ca+2 channel by binding to alpha subunit
↓
Prevent entry of ca+2 into cell
↓
No excitation contraction coupling in heart and vascular smooth muscle
↓bp
•Nifedipine safe in pregnancy .

MOA of beta# and alpha #
Selective beta # - B1
Non selective - B1 B2
During initial therapy b1# - ↓co
B2 # ↑pvr
Overall bp unaffected
But chronic use - gradual decrease in pvr because of sustained ↓ vo ; bp ↓
Beta # - .Cns ↓ SYM. Outflow ↓ bp
.heart ↓ hr ↓foc ↓co. ↓ bp
Kidney ↓ renin release ↓ bp
Alpha #
Non selective
Block both a1 and a2 in blood vessel
↓
Vasodilation and ↓ bp( a1 block)
Tachycardia (due to ↑↑ noradrenaline dur to presynaptic a2 block)
Selective a1#
Block competitively a1
Vasodilation ↓ bp
Minimal tachycardia
